#bf6574 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f6574 is composed of 74.9% red, 39.6%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.1% magenta, 39.3%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 350 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 57.3%. #bf6574 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cae8 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#bf6574 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f6574 has RGB values of R:191, G:101,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.39,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12543348.

Shades and Tints of #bf6574
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0506 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f6574
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#958f90 is the less saturated color, while #fa2a4d is the most saturated one.
